College Campus, Junagadh-362 001, India E-mail: sibajisarkar004@gmail.com; rs_yunus@rediffmail.com Substituted-1,3-benzothiazole is synthesized by 2-amino- 7-chloro-6-fluorobenzothiazoles with aroyl chloride and later on obtained compound were refluxed in equimolecular with various substituted amines. These were characterized by spectral data and were screened for biological and pharmacological activity. Key Words: Phenyl carboxamido benzothiazoles, Antibac- terial and Antifungal activity. INTRODUCTION A number of the fluro benzothiazoles 1 were reported to possess different biological and pharmacological activities 2-7 . These observations stimulated us with a presumption that phenyl carboxamido benzothiazoles would produce new compounds of better activities. EXPERIMENTAL All melting points were taken in open capillary tube and are uncorrected. The IR spectra were recorded with KBR pellets on Shimadzu FT-IR-8400S Spectrophotometer. 1 H NMR were recorded on Avance 300 MHz spectro- photometer. Synthesis of 7-chloro-6-fluoro-2-(substituted phenyl carboxamido) benzothiazole: A solution of triethylamine (0.101 g, 0.001 mol) and 2-amino-7-chloro-6-fluoro benzothiazole (II) (0.203 g, 0.001 mol) in 10 mL of 1,4-dioxane was stirred on a magnetic stirrer at 50-60 ºC for 1 h.
